BTW "Nitpick_Examples" should have been failing all over the place. If they haven't, this indicates that neither of your two setups (macbroy2 and local machine) have Kodkod enabled.

Is there any reference to these details on some documentation (README, manual, …)? A grep for Kodkod over the sources did not look very promising.

A good starting point is the semi-official Admin/contributed_components file, which seems to be also used officially for Mira tests. It documents potentially relevant external components for tests. The versions given there are not necessarily the latest ones, but the simplest ones to install from the last official release bundle (directory contrib/).

Eg. version edd50ec8d471 of the file still refers to contrib/scala-2.8.1.final from Isabelle2011-1, although the "latest" snapshots already uses scala-2.8.2.final, while the next release will potentially move forward to scala 2.9.x -- just the usual entertainment.


More specific information about isatest settings is in Admin/isatest/settings/, but that is much less comprehensive. I can't say myself on the spot if every add-on is really tested. How about the many variations on Predicate_Compile, code generator etc?
